Name of Dish: Chicken Balti

All our baltis are served with a complimentary nan bread (Indian bread)

Ingredients: Balti paste, spices, butter, methi, coriander,

Method of cooking: Shallow fried onion, tomatoes, capsicum all blended with spices and then cooked in a cast iron kashmiri pan

Time of cooking: 10 minutes

Level of heat: Standard comes as medium but can be heated up according to taste such as can be made more spicy if required.

 

There is a difference of opinion as to the origin of the Balti curry.  There are some who believe it originated in Baltistan in Kashmir whilst others believe the Balti was born in Birmingham in the 1980s, spreading in popularity to the rest of the UK in the 1990s.

Try it with: We think the perfect appetizers for a Balti  are onion bhajis and  nan with chicken tikka.

 

Onion Bhaji - Gram flour mixed with onions and spices and then shallow fried into balls - we do 4 in a portion (Medium hot)

 

Nan with chicken tikka - BBQ cubes of chicken placed in nan bread and then rolled up to make it a chicken tikka roll (Mild-medium hot)
